For best results, you should be level 90 or higher with 900+GP available to use. In my own runs, I'm using fully pentamelded gathering gear with 973 GP. Please note that as far as food goes, the focus is on GP+ and not on actual stats like perception or gathering. This is because stats have little to no influence in what you catch while on the boat.
Please note that your success rates will vary. Some runs will be very low scoring, others can be very high. Ocean Trip has less to do with stats and everything to do with RNG. You can manipulate some factors, such as double hooking at the right time and identical casting when required. I've hit 20k points using this bot many times now, so I know it's easily accomplished.

When Ocean Fishing:
-
Specify Fishing Priority
- Automatic (Default) - Will focus on Fishing Log when missing fish are available, otherwise focuses on points.
- Points - Self explainatory, will focus on getting points based on DH / TH values of fish available.
- Fishing Log - Self explainatory, will focus on catching fish you have not caught.
- Achievements (Currently Disabled - Work in Progress) - Focus on the various fishing achievements such as catching Jellyfish.
- Ignore Boat - This will allow you to utilize the BotBase in order to focus on the "Idle" activities such as raid preparation.
-
Fishing Route
- Indigo - The "original" route for Ocean Fishing, with zones such as Rothlyt Sound
- Ruby - This is the route introduced after Endwalker, the "Ruby Sea"
-
Full GP Actions
- None - Don't do anything outside of normal logic when player GP is full. This is the recommended setting.
- Double/Triple Hook - This will automatically double or triple hook (based on GP and skill availability) when GP is full.
- Chum - This will automatically chum when the player is full on GP.
-
Trip Options
- Late Queue - This will queue up for the boat around the 13 minute mark. If disabled, will queue up as soon as the boat is available.
- Ocean Food - This will have the player eat a predefined food that grants the most GP upon boarding the boat. As of DawnTrail 7.0 release, this is Nasi Goreng. This is subject to change with future releases and may not match what I've listed in this readme.
-
Use Patience Skill
- Default Logic - Will only activate Patience for certain fish that require it. Recommended if level 90 or above.
- Spectral Only - Will activate Patience Skill for Spectral events and try to keep it active during the spectral.
- Always - Will always try to keep Patience active. Recommended if below level 90 to catch large fish.
-
Fish Exchange
- None - Keep all the fish you catch.
- Desynthesize - As it sounds, will Desynthesize all ocean fish you have caught except for the Spectral Blue's.
- Sell - Sell all the ocean fish you have caught except for the Spectral Blue's.

There is an additional option to enable or disable "Open World Fishing". This allows you to settle down at a fishing hole, cast your line with whatever bait you wish and have the bot take over to auto-hook, auto-cast, or auto-mooch. It will not manage your bait for you, but will give you a brief pause before auto-casting to allow you to change bait or use abilities such as Prize Catch. This is not intended to catch big-fish, but will allow you to sit back and relax while filling your fishing log.
In the Ocean Settings screen, there is a Tacklebox panel. This panel will show you all the bait required for Ocean Fishing. This is combined between Indigo and Ruby. It is recommended that you have all the necessary bait to go fishing, even if you are under level 90. You can mouse-over the icon for each bait to know what the bait is. The count that appears under the bait icon is how much bait is in your inventory. Ocean Trip will not factor in any bait that you have in a retainer, so make sure to keep it in your inventory or else it may try to restock
-
Restock Threshold - If the bait in your inventory goes below this number, the BotBase will try to restock before the next Ocean Trip begins.
-
Restock Amount - If the BotBase goes below the threshold and requires restocking, it will purchase bait until you have this amount in your inventory. In case the bait is a lure, it will restock up to 15. This is because you can occasionally lose a lure during fishing (although uncommon).
